git config –global user.email “用户邮箱” #设置邮箱 git pull 每次提交代码前,先同步远端代码,以防覆盖别人代码;如果出现冲突,先备份自己的代码,然后合并进去,再提交代码。git status 查看当前状态(这一步可以省略)git add 一般为情况一,全部提交或部分文件提交 git commitgit push 代码冲突...
常用git命令以及问题提交代码,合并冲突
git常用命令(简介,详细参数往下看)
git fetch 获取远程分支更新
git branch 查看本地分支
git branch -r 查看远程分支
git branch -a 查看所有分支(本地分支和远程分支)
git clone 地址 克隆代码
git checkout 切换分支
git pull 同步到本地(拉)
git push 推送至服务器
git checkout -b dev origin/master 基于主分支创建dev分支
git add . 添加到缓存
git commit -m “提交说明” 将暂存区内容提交到本地仓库
git commit -a -m “提交说明” 跳过缓存区操作,直接把工作区内容提交到本地仓库
git status 查看仓库当前状态
git配置
git config –global user.name “用户名” # 设置用户名
git config –global user.email “用户邮箱” #设置邮箱
git pull 每次提交代码前,先同步远端代码,以防覆盖别人代码;
如果出现冲突,先备份自己的代码,然后合并进去,再提交代码。
git status 查看当前状态(这一步可以省略)
git add 一般为情况一,全部提交或部分文件提交
git commitgit push
代码冲突合并问题
方法一:放弃本地代码
方法二:合并代码
git stash:保存当前工作进度
git pull:拉取服务器仓库代码
git stash pop:合并代码
git stash list:查看本地stash日志
git stash clear: 清空Git栈
git代码冲突合并时,使用git stash、git pull、git stash pop、git stash list、git stash clear
常用命令以及详细参数
git add 将文件添加到仓库
git diff 比较文件异同
git log 查看历史记录
git reset 代码回滚
版本库相关操作
删除版本库文件
远程仓库相关操作
同步远程仓库
分支相关操作创建、查看、合并、删除分支
删除分支:git branch -d dev
查看分支合并图:git log –graph –pretty=oneline –abbrev-commit
撤消某次提交:git revert HEAD 或 git revert 版本号
git用户名密码相关配置
设置用户信息:git config –global user.name “用户名” # 设置用户名
git config –global user.email “用户邮箱” #设置邮箱2024-10-26